Client (sic) frames argv as netstrings and pipes it over ssh to a daemon (sicd) that execvp's it, so no shell re-parses the arguments. exec mode by default; opt-in sh mode for pipes/redirects/globs. Go client + daemon, Python reference daemon, design doc, quoting-hell demo, and foreground/background agent skills. Renamed from the climcp prototype. print("""
|
|
The pattern in every case:
|
|
SSH → flattens argv to one string, shell re-parses → QUOTING HELL
|
|
rs → sends argv as framed fields, execvp directly → NO ESCAPING
|
|
|
|
Netstrings (length:bytes,) are the key: the length tells the parser
|
|
exactly where each field ends, so NO delimiter needs escaping.
|
|
This is the same insight as git -z / find -print0 / xargs -0,
|
|
but generalized to arbitrary remote command execution.
|
|
""")
